Blockchain gaming is not a new concept, as the release of CryptoKitties in 2017 once made the concept of blockchain gaming widely known and was a significant source of congestion on the Ethereum network at the time, with CryptoKitties accounting for 25% of Ethereum network traffic at its peak.

The GameFi Market With Unlimited Potential

According to a report by NewZoo, a specialist gaming analysis website, gaming has become one of the fastest-growing media segments, with the global gaming market expected to grow from $160 billion in 2020 to $200 billion by 2023.

Furthermore, according to its research, 74% of total game revenue in 2020 is generated through in-game transactions, indicating that players are generally willing to buy in-game props.

However, in traditional games, in-game items do not fully belong to the owner, and the purchase of in-game items by the user can be considered a form of ‘rental’. Because these items are locked into the game, the real ownership of the items is in the hands of the publisher, who determines their properties, use, availability, and price. Traditional games are developed on a centralized platform and if the game is stopped or closed, the in-game props will no longer exist and the props themselves can only be used for a specific game.

The development of blockchain games can ensure that when in-game items become the digital assets of the holder, the ownership of the item is truly in the hands of the player, and the P2E model can even generate income for the player, rewarding the player for participating in the game by allowing the game props to be traded freely and turned into real-world fiat money at any time, anywhere, furthering the positive cycle of the game and continuously increasing the flow of players.

According to dappradar data, the total number of games included is now over a thousand, with Axie Infinity alone having 800,000+ users in the last thirty days, over 10 million transactions and a total transaction volume of $2 billion. Although it is still only the tip of the iceberg compared to the traditional gaming market share, the speed of development cannot be underestimated, especially as the huge benefit effect is accelerating the influx of more traffic.

Why is REI Network suitable for GameFi developers?

The 2017 CryptoKitties boom clogged up the Ethereum network, which also reduced the user experience of CryptoKitties due to the Ethereum network’s inefficiencies, and eventually fell out of favor with users.

In 2021, the maturity of new public chains and layer 2 networks has allowed the blockchain game to progress much further. Axie Infinity is using a build an Ethereum sidechain, Ronin, and Alien Worlds has chosen to develop on a new public chain, BSC/WAX, with a PoS consensus mechanism that reduces transaction fees and increases transaction speed. REI Network is also A new public chain with a PoS consensus mechanism, which is faster while ensuring the security of transactions. In addition, compared to public chains such as BSC/WAX, users on REI Network can pledge their REI passes through Staking to obtain on-chain computing resources with little to no fees, which is a huge advantage for high-frequency transactions such as gaming
